Best huts around Borsdorf are found within this municipality in the Leipzig district of Saxony, Germany. The area is characterized by its natural landscapes, including forests and local recreational areas. While not known for traditional mountain cabins, Borsdorf and its surroundings offer various shelters and designated rest areas categorized as huts. These structures provide points of interest for hikers and nature enthusiasts exploring the region's trails.

Around Borsdorf, 'huts' typically refer to various shelters, designated rest areas, and unique indoor facilities rather than traditional mountain cabins. These include forest shelters, lakeside rest areas, and even a large tropical hall, all providing points of interest for visitors.
Yes, several facilities are family-friendly. For instance, the Küchenholz Hut is a forest hut rebuilt after a storm, offering a welcoming spot. The Gondwanaland Jungle Experience (Zoo Leipzig) is also categorized as a family-friendly 'hut' within the zoo, providing a unique tropical environment.
The Six-way junction in Planitzwald is an idyllic spot in the middle of the forest, offering numerous seating options, both open and covered. Another great option is the Shelter on the Path of Songs, which provides a cozy refuge perfect for a snack break, rain or shine.
Yes, you can find the Rest area at the wooden hut by the lake. This spot offers a small hut, a table, and benches right by the water, making it a pleasant place to relax.
The Küchenholz Hut features unique small panes on its interior wall. The Gondwanaland Jungle Experience (Zoo Leipzig) offers a large indoor tropical hall with a warm, humid climate, diverse flora, and fauna, providing a distinct experience unlike traditional outdoor huts.
The area around Borsdorf offers various outdoor activities. You can explore MTB trails, go cycling, or enjoy running trails. Many routes pass by or are close to these designated rest areas and shelters.
Yes, for example, the Shelter on the Path of Songs is located directly on the Path of Songs, which is part of a longer route from Halle-Schkeuditz to Grimma. The Six-way junction in Planitzwald is also a key resting point within the Planitzwald forest, integrated into various walking paths.
Visitors appreciate the peaceful and idyllic breaks offered by spots like the Six-way junction in Planitzwald. The unique atmosphere of the Gondwanaland Jungle Experience is also highly rated, with many enjoying the tropical climate and diverse wildlife. The community values these spots for their opportunities to relax and connect with nature.
Borsdorf itself is not known for traditional mountain cabins or remote wilderness shelters. The 'huts' in this municipality are more commonly shelters, rest areas, or unique indoor facilities. For traditional mountain huts, you would need to explore the wider Saxony region, particularly its more mountainous areas like Saxon Switzerland.
At locations like the Six-way junction in Planitzwald, you can find signposts and information boards, which are helpful for navigating the trails and learning about the surrounding area.
When visiting the Rest area at the wooden hut by the lake, visitors are encouraged to keep the area clean. For the Gondwanaland Jungle Experience, it's advised to dress in layers due to the warm and humid tropical climate inside.
